FFA
Instructor: Mr. Beggs/Ms. Goodwin   
FFA represents the relevancy to the core areas offering students opportunities that changes lives and prepares students for premier leadership, personal growth and career success. Founded in 1928, the FFA organization represents a large diversity of over 300 careers in the food, fiber and natural resources industry. FFA is an integral part of a school system.

FFA uses agricultural education to create real-world success.Agriculture teachers become advisors to local FFA chapters, which students join. More than 7,000 FFA chapters are currently in existence; their programs are managed on a local,state and national level. Each chapter’s Program of Activities is designed with the needs of the students in mind.Activities vary greatly from school to school, but are based in a well-integrated curriculum. Chapter activities and FFA programs concentrate on three areas of our mission: premier leadership, personal growth and career success.

The FFA Mission

The National FFA Organization is dedicated to making a positive difference in the lives of students by developing their potential for premier leadership, personal growth and career success through agricultural education.

The FFA Motto

The FFA motto gives members twelve short words to live by as they experience the opportunities in the organization.

Learning to Do - Doing to Learn - Earning to Live - Living to Serve.

TSU Invitational

Coleman FFA Competes at the Tarleton State University CDE's

 

The Coleman FFA Judging Teams traveled to Stephenville on Thursday, March 24th to compete in the Tarleton State University Invitational CDE's.

This contest is the largest judging contest in the state with over 7,000 contestants entered!  Coleman FFA competed in five judging events including Land, Dairy Foods, Horse, Livestock, and Dairy Cattle.  The Land Evaluation team had a very successful day placing 5th overall out of 110 teams entered.  The Dairy Foods team also did well placing 27th out of 140 teams.  FFA members pictured are: Chanie Barker, Mercedes Taylor, Jackie Birdwell, Cheyenne Gammage, Chelsey Day, Tanner Strickland, Sarah Wickson, Kelby McCorkle, Marcelino Felipe, Chase Huddle, James Stephenson, Lucia Carrasco, Autum White, Miranda Slone, Draven DeLaGarza, Jayce Simmons, Colton Smith, Brent Ogden, John Buckaloo, Colton Smith, Justin Hensley, and Cody Cogdill. These teams will travel to Tarleton State University again on April 6th for the Area Contest.  Congratulations to all teams on a job well done!

Weatherford CDE's

Coleman FFA Places 2nd at Weatherford College Invitational

 

The Coleman FFA Land Evaluation and Horse Judging Teams traveled to Weatherford on Wednesday, March 23rd to compete in the Weatherford College Invitational CDE's.  The Land Evaluation team placed 2nd overall out of 22 teams from around the state.  Tanner Strickland was the top scoring individual out of 88 competitors.  The Horse judging team also had a very successful day.  Those participating in the contest and pictured from left to right are (front row) Colton Smith, Cheyenne Gammage, Chanie Barker, and Laiken Barnett (back row) Draven DeLaGarza, Colton Smith, Chase Huddle, Tanner Strickland, and Kelby McCorkle.  Congratulations to both teams on a job well done!

FFA Leadership Teams Qualify for Area Contest

FIVE COLEMAN FFA MEMBERS QUALIFIED to compete in the Area IV Leadership contest which was held in Stephenville on November 20, 2010. To qualify for the event, contestants had to place first or second at the district contest which was held in Cisco on the previous Monday.  Those qualifying and pictured from left to right are the Senior Skills team consisting of Tanner Strickland, Sarah Wickson, Kelby McCorkle, and Chanie Barker.  Also pictured is Taylor Kubla who qualified in Jr. Creed.  At Area the Senior Skills team was 7th, and Jr. Creed  was 5th.

 

Twelve Coleman FFA members competed at the District Contest in Cisco on November 15th.  Those participating are as follows.  Sarah Wickson, Chanie Barker, Tanner Strickland, and Kelby McCorkle placing 1st in Senior Skills, Taylor Kublala placing 2nd in Jr. Creed, Laiken Barnett placing 3rd in Sr. Creed, Autum White placing 5th in Job Interview, Shi Brudney, Marissa Hamon, and Autum White placing 7th in Radio, and Taylor Kubla, Coleton Smith, and Gatlin Barker placing 11th in Jr Quiz.   Congratulations to all Coleman FFA Leadership Teams on a job well done!

Greenhand Camp
Coleman FFA Greenhand Officers attended the Area IV Greenhand Camp on Tuesday September 21st in Graham Texas. Area IV Greenhand Camp is one of the largest in the state with over 1,100 students in attendance. This camp teaches students leadership skills, communication skills, and promotes involvement in the FFA organization.
